Second Test against India: England selectors add Saqib Mahmood

| @indiablooms | Aug 12, 2021, at 12:54 am

London/UNI: Fast bowler Saqib Mahmood has been added to England squad as cover for the second Test against India, the England and Wales Cricket Board announced on Wednesday.

'Seamer @SaqMahmood25 has been added to our squad as cover for the second Test against India. Spinner Dom Bess will leave the squad and return to Yorkshire,' the board said in a tweet.

Mahmood's call-up came with veteran pacer Stuart Broad facing a calf injury which may rule him out of the second Test, starting on Thursday.

Broad, 35, is awaiting the results of a scan after appearing to slip while undertaking a light warm-up jog during training. He will be assessed by physios before a decision is made over his availability for what would be his 150th Test.

The veteran pacer had claimed KL Rahul's wicket in India's first innings on the fourth day of the first day before rain washed out an intriguing final day.

He currently has 524 wickets at 27.84 in his 149 Tests to date, placing him sixth on the all-time Test wicket-takers list.

Mahmood, 24, is uncapped at Test level but he was named man of the series during the recent white-ball series against Pakistan.

The first Test of the five-match series between England and India at Trent Bridge ended in a draw on Sunday. With the game evenly poised, both teams were left frustrated on the final day as the game was called off without a ball being bowled.
